Silvia

Silvia is the 6,346th most common surname in the United States, shared by 5,153 people at the 2020 census. That is about one person in 58,000.

Where the name comes from

Feminine form of Silvius. In myths, Rhea Silvia was the mother of famous twins Romulus and Remus, the founders of Rome. 6th-century saint Silvia was the mother of the pope Gregory the Great.

Source: US Census Bureau, Frequently Occurring Surnames, 2020. The Census describes the file as the surnames borne by 100 or more people; rarer names are not published. The line is not quite exact, and 617 published names come in under it, the smallest at 92 people. Race and Hispanic origin are self-reported. Rates are worked out against the 298.9 million people the file's own figures are calculated on, which is fewer than the census counted in all: the difference is everyone whose surname was too rare to publish.
